Vontier, spun off from Fortive in 2020, is an industrial technology company with a portfolio of transportation and mobility solutions. The company offers a wide array of products and services, including fueling equipment, sensors, point-of-sale and payment systems, telematics, and equipment used by vehicle mechanics and technicians. Vontier generated approximately $3 billion in sales in 2024.
Seaboard Corp is a diversified group of companies that operate in agricultural, energy, and ocean transport businesses. The company is engaged in hog production, biofuel production, and pork processing in the United States; commodity trading and grain processing in Africa and South America; cargo shipping services in the U.S., Caribbean and Central and South America; sugar and alcohol production in Argentina; and electric power generation in the Dominican Republic. It also has an equity method investment in Butterball, LLC, a producer and processor of turkey products. The group's operating segments are; pork, commodity trading and milling, marine, liquid fuels, power, turkey, and others. It operates in 45 countries, with a concentration in the Caribbean, Central and South American region.
